Nightmarket - Games of Chance
Deep in the heart of the Kaiser's Bazaar runs the Nightmarket. A disconnected bunch of cut-throats, thieves, burglars, muggers, bandits, boosters, gamblers, embezzlers, pirates, and swindlers that deal in the businesses everyone knows about, but no one wants to talk about.
Gambling is one of those businesses, and business is booming. Nightmarket - Games of Chance contains three gambling houses that operate inside the Kaiser's Bazaar (or anywhere in your game world) among the legal shops. Each one is of varying levels of prestige and safety to accommodate your style of play and to add variety to your cities.
- THE IDLE HOUND (SECRET GAMBLING HALL): Located on a peculiarly busy side street of the Brewer's Market (See: The Kaiser's Bazaar - Book A), just off Black-Oak Way, the Idle Hound is a backdoor gambling hall that caters to a broad cross-section of the city's population. 'The Hound', as it's called by locals, isn't so much secret as it is deliberately overlooked. An elaborate network of bribery and blackmail provides the foundation for its continued existence, as does the fact that its owner is a prominent and wealthy sorcerer. A well described casino with six fantasy-inspired games of chance for your players to throw their coins at.
- LAELIN D'ORBB (DROW SPIDER-FIGHTING): The spider-fighting games are both an ancient tradition and highly illegal bloodsport. The spider fights have long been very popular with big money gamblers, thieves, and sailors, drawing large crowds when a match is privately announced. A violent sport for only the most blood-thirsty, the Spider-Fights attract the worst sort of lowlife in town.
- RAFF-N-RABBLEDASH (RAT RACES): Secretly tucked underneath the Main Dock at Blackwater Close, this short wooden den is slung between the sturdy dock supports behind Handsome Seret's Crab Boil. Owned and operated by the Sackheel Bunch for nearly a hundred years, in one secret hide-out or another, the 'dashes have long been a favorite pastime for the local halfling unwashed.
